Increased outburst flood hazard from Lake Palcacocha due to human-induced glacier retreat

R. F. Stuart-Smith et al.

Summary: The retreat of Palcaraju glacier and expansion of Palcacocha lake are mainly attributed to human-induced global warming, which has significantly increased the glacial lake outburst flood hazard in Huaraz. Observations suggest that between 85-105% of the observed 1 degrees Celsius warming since 1880 in this region is due to anthropogenic factors, impacting the glacier retreat and flood risk.

Accelerated global glacier mass loss in the early twenty-first century

Romain Hugonnet et al.

Summary: The study found that glaciers around the world are melting at an accelerated rate, with contrasting patterns of mass loss in different geographical regions. Overall, glaciers are losing mass more rapidly, with similar or even larger acceleration rates than Greenland or Antarctic ice sheets taken separately. These findings also highlight the importance of understanding drivers that influence glacier change to predict future changes and mitigate the impacts of sea-level rise.
